Table of Contents
The landscape of JavaScript SEO is rapidly evolving as search engines become more sophisticated in their ability to crawl, render, and understand JavaScript-based websites. Staying ahead of these changes is crucial for digital marketers, developers, and content creators aiming to optimize their online presence.
Current State of JavaScript SEO
Traditionally, search engines struggled to index JavaScript-heavy websites effectively. However, recent advancements in rendering capabilities, particularly by Google, have improved the situation significantly. Today, Google can render and index most JavaScript content, but challenges remain with complex scripts and dynamic content.
Emerging Algorithm Trends
Several key trends are shaping the future of JavaScript SEO:
- Enhanced Rendering Capabilities: Search engines are investing in better rendering infrastructure to handle complex JavaScript frameworks.
- Focus on Core Web Vitals: Page experience signals like loading speed, interactivity, and visual stability are increasingly influencing rankings.
- AI and Machine Learning: Algorithms are becoming better at understanding context and user intent, reducing reliance on traditional keyword signals.
- Progressive Enhancement: Websites that progressively enhance content for different devices and browsers are favored.
- Structured Data and Semantic Markup: Proper use of schema.org and other structured data helps search engines understand content better.
Predictions for the Future
Based on current trends, several predictions can be made about the future of JavaScript SEO:
- Greater Reliance on Server-Side Rendering (SSR): To improve crawlability and performance, more sites will adopt SSR or static site generation.
- Advanced Indexing Techniques: Search engines may develop more sophisticated methods to interpret dynamic and interactive content.
- Increased Emphasis on User Experience: Metrics like dwell time, bounce rate, and engagement will play larger roles in rankings.
- Integration of AI Tools: SEO tools will leverage AI to analyze JavaScript-heavy sites and suggest optimizations.
- Enhanced Developer Guidelines: Search engines will provide clearer best practices for JavaScript implementation to facilitate better indexing.
Strategies for Future Readiness
To prepare for these upcoming changes, developers and marketers should focus on:
- Optimizing Performance: Minimize JavaScript payloads and leverage code splitting.
- Implementing Structured Data: Use schema markup to clarify content meaning.
- Ensuring Accessibility and Progressive Enhancement: Make sure content is accessible without JavaScript where possible.
- Monitoring and Testing: Regularly test sites with tools like Google Search Console and Lighthouse.
- Staying Informed: Follow updates from search engines and SEO communities.
The future of JavaScript SEO promises both challenges and opportunities. By understanding emerging trends and adapting strategies accordingly, website owners can ensure their content remains visible and competitive in an increasingly dynamic digital landscape.